Home treatments for joint pain may include ice or heat. Cold therapy can reduce swelling and relieve pain in the joint. Heat can relieve spasms in the muscles surrounding the joint. A balanced exercise program may be recommended to restore strength and flexibility. Some people may benefit from antidepressants or other drugs to improve sleep and decrease joint pain. Some physicians prescribe painkillers to ease symptoms and reduce inflammation. Even simple exercises can help alleviate pain.

Your doctor will first perform a physical examination and discuss your medical history. He or she may ask you about your pain history and whether you have family history of joint disease. The doctor may perform tests, such as x-rays, to ensure that the pain is not coming from an underlying problem. Joint pain treatment may also include simple lifestyle modifications and home care. Overuse injuries may lead to joint pain. This can be the result of repetitive motions such as playing sports or musical instruments. Some people experience joint pain due to a viral infection or a fever. Another common cause of joint pain is tendinitis, which involves inflammation of the tendons that connect bones. Depending on the cause of the pain, tendonitis can require a prescription medication or even surgery.
